Sample Itinerary Days
You Can Choose From!
Arrival in Hokkaido (Noboribetsu)
Ease into rest and reconnection.
Arrival & Transfer: Land at New Chitose Airport (Sapporo) and transfer (1.5 hrs) to Bourou Noguchi Noboribetsu, your luxurious onsen ryokan.
Afternoon: Settle into your room with forest views; enjoy tea in silence.
Evening: Begin with a kaiseki dinner and early onsen soak before sleep.
Geothermal Energy & Grounding
Morning: Guided walk through Jigokudani (Hell Valley) — experience the earth’s pulse through its steaming vents.
Afternoon: Optional meditation beside Oyunuma Pond, followed by a light lunch of soba and mountain vegetables.
Evening: Private onsen soak and herbal tea session in your suite.
Healing Through Stillness
Morning: Easy forest trail walk or gentle stretching in the ryokan garden.
Afternoon: Reiki or reflexology session arranged by the concierge.
Evening: Seasonal kaiseki dinner — Hokkaido seafood and mountain herbs.
Reflection & Renewal
Morning: Visit Lake Kuttara, a pristine volcanic crater lake.
Afternoon: Journal or read in the ryokan lounge overlooking cedar hills.
Evening: Optional spa ritual and final soak beneath open air.
Journey to Kyoto Countryside (Kameoka)
Morning: Transfer to New Chitose Airport, fly to Osaka (Itami).
Afternoon: Private car or train transfer (1 hr) to Satoyama no Kyujitsu Kyoto Keburikawa.
Evening: Dinner featuring vegetables grown on-site; unwind in the open-air onsen surrounded by forest.
Nature as Teacher
Morning: Gentle yoga session followed by breakfast overlooking rice fields.
Afternoon: Field walk or cycling through Satoyama’s farmlands.
Evening: Handicraft workshop — try incense making or indigo dyeing.
The Art of Slow Living
Morning: Tea meditation or reading in the courtyard.
Afternoon: Optional day trip to Arashiyama, visiting bamboo groves and Tenryu-ji Temple.
Evening: Return for dinner and a final footbath under lantern light.
Departure & Reflection
Morning: Farewell breakfast and countryside stroll.
Transfer: Return to Kyoto or Osaka for flight home.
